Our Lady Help Of Christians
Open
710 State St
New Orleans, LA 70118
Our Lady Help Of Christians is a welcoming church organization located in New Orleans, LA. Known for its vibrant community and diverse programs, it serves as a spiritual home for worshippers and visitors alike. The organization focuses on fostering faith, outreach, and support through various services and events that enrich the lives of its members and the surrounding community.
Generated from this place's information
Also at this address
See a problem?
You might also like
Partial Data by Foursquare.